Giant Eagle, Inc., a prominent player in the grocery and retail industry, is headquartered in the United States, specifically in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. Founded in 1931, the company has grown to become one of the largest supermarket chains in the region, primarily serving customers in Pennsylvania, Ohio, West Virginia, and Maryland. Specialising in a diverse range of products, Giant Eagle offers fresh produce, quality meats, and a variety of grocery items, alongside pharmacy and fuel services. The company is renowned for its commitment to local sourcing and community engagement, setting it apart from competitors. With a strong market position, Giant Eagle has achieved numerous accolades, including recognition for its customer service and sustainability initiatives, solidifying its reputation as a trusted retailer in the grocery sector.

Giant Eagle, Inc., headquartered in the US, currently does not have publicly available carbon emissions data for the most recent year, nor does it report specific reduction targets or initiatives. As of now, there are no emissions figures provided, indicating a lack of disclosed Scope 1, 2, or 3 emissions data. Additionally, the company has not committed to any science-based targets or climate pledges, nor does it inherit any emissions data from a parent or related organization.
